#f7b023 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f7b023 is composed of 96.9% red, 69%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.9 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 55.3%. #f7b023 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#ef6100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#f7b023

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7b023

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8d8c is the less saturated color, while #f7b023 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f7b023 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b5b5b5 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c2b498 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d7c031 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f0b72c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ffa8b4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e2ba2c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#f2b428 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fcab7f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
